March 6 &7, 2010
Psalm 13
Have you ever felt as if your prayers were just bouncing off the ceiling?
Read Psalm 13, I’ll wait here till you get back…
Wow, your not alone are you? David didn’t just paint on a happy face and pretend like everything was OK when his life was in turmoil. David was honest about his feelings, yet they did not rule his life, govern his actions or drive him into hopeless depression. Instead they drove him to the throne of God. He didn’t instruct God how to fix the problem, his request was for God to consider his trial, hear his prayer and give him understanding. In the end the thing that changed was David’s perspective, from earthly to heavenly. David states, in spite of the way I feel and what I’m going through, “I have trusted in Your mercy; My heart shall rejoice in Your salvation. I will sing to the Lord, because He has dealt bountifully with me.”
Can I see in my own life, that when I have trusted God through trials, He has dealt bountifully with me? Do I understand looking back that He is working his eternal purpose in my life? Will I trust that He has my best interest at heart? Can I say, “Therefore we do not lose heart. Even though our outward man is perishing, yet the inward man is being renewed day by day. For our light affliction, which is but for a moment, is working for us a far more exceeding and external weight of glory,” (2 Cor. 16-17)
